At its core, project management is about aligning people, priorities, and processes to reach a clear goal—on time and with fewer headaches. It’s not just a to-do list with a deadline; it’s the art of anticipating obstacles, balancing resources, managing expectations, and leading teams through uncertainty with confidence.
